Joyful Rebellion. I love the feel of those words. Joyful Rebellion. Let's dive into exploring what this is in this episode of SelfKind with Erica Webb (that's me!). Joyful rebellion is my current favourite way of describing the joy that can come with recognising your capacity for choice, stepping away from reflexive guilt and allowing yourself to connect with your needs, desires and joy.
